I was wondering if people would share their experience with AAA hotel discounts, when staying on property. As an APH, we were hoping for APH discount rates in August at Pop Century. Those APH discounts seem to be fewer and fewer each year. We will be at Pop from 1-14 Aug.

Is the AAA discount a % or flat dollar amount?
Does it vary, based on the level of room?
Does it vary , based on the time of year?
Can you modify an existing reservation with the AAA discount, to get the lower rate?

We get two rooms and since we are staying two weeks, even a $5/day/room discount would pay for the AAA membership in a single trip.

I always book with AAA first, then when and if the AP rates come out I have the AP rates applied. I forget what the AAA rate is, it is different for different levels of resorts, but if memory serves me, I believe it was about 10% for the values.

Also there AAA ratres are not available all the time. There are only a limited number of rooms available for the rate.

In value season, AAA provides a 20% discount at value and moderate resorts, and 15% off at the deluxe and DVC properties, subject to availability.
In regular and peak seasons, the AAA discount is 15% at the values and moderates and then 10% at the deluxe and DVC properties. There are no AAA discounts during holiday season.
